Is qBittorrent free? Yes, qBittorrent is completely free to use and does not contain any ads or malware. Can I use qBittorrent anonymously? Yes, qBittorrent supports anonymous downloading through Tor and I2P networks. Does qBittorrent support RSS feeds? Yes, qBittorrent has a built-in RSS feed reader which allows you to automatically download torrents based on RSS feeds. Can I schedule downloads with qBittorrent? Yes, qBittorrent allows you to schedule downloads for specific times and days. Is it possible to limit the upload speed in qBittorrent? Yes, qBittorrent allows you to set global and per-torrent upload limits. Does qBittorrent have a web interface? Yes, qBittorrent has a powerful web interface that allows you to manage your torrents remotely. Can I use qBittorrent to search for torrents? Yes, qBittorrent has a built-in search engine that allows you to search for torrents on popular torrent sites. Does qBittorrent have a mobile app? Qbittorrent does not have an official mobile app, but there are third-party apps available for Android and iOS. Can I use qBittorrent to stream video files? No, qBittorrent does not have a built-in video player for streaming video files; however, you can use third-party applications to stream videos. Speed up qbittorrent. Use the anonymous mode in Germany to hide some information about yourself. This mode hides the IP address, Peer ID, user agents, and more. You can easily enable this mode by visiting Tools. After this, go to Options > Bittorent. Lastly, checkmark the box present beside “Enable anonymous Mode.”While the Anonymous mode is safe, you cannot compare it to a VPN as it doesn’t encrypt your activity. In fact, this mode should be used along with a VPN service for complete protection in Germany.Is qBittorrent Legal in Germany?Yes, qBittorrent is legal to use in Germany. There are a few changes you can make to your qBittorrent setting for better speed and security. Here is a list of all these changes listed by Reddit and Quora users:You need to ensure that qBittorrent is using a 10,000+ port.Ensure that there is no Global Rate Limit. Set them to infinity.To locate a few more peers, enable DHT, Local Peer Discovery, and PEX.To eliminate speed throttling, you need to disable uTP. For this, visit Tools, then go to Options > ConnectionComments

2025-04-09The message column will say "This torrent is private".I wrote a patch for qBittorrent, to whom can I send it?You can fork our GitHub repository and make a pull request on GitHub.Who is developing qBittorrent?qBittorrent was created in March 2006 by chris@qbittorrent.org and was actively maintained/developed by him until July 2013.After that sledgehammer999@qbittorrent.org is maintaining the project.Many other people have contributed or are still contributing to the project.If you like the software and you would like to help the project to subsist by giving some money, please do so here.We thank you in advance.Which operating systems are currently supported by qBittorrent?qBittorrent code compiles on Unix-like systems (GNU/Linux, BSD, OS X, ...) and Windows.Windows is officially supported as of qBittorrent 2.2.9.Is qBittorrent available on my GNU/Linux distribution?qBittorrent is included in the official repositories of several major GNU/Linux distributions (Ubuntu, Linux Mint, Fedora, Debian, Gentoo, Arch Linux, …).Binary distributions are usually available to the other distros through 3rd party repositories.If not, please file a request at your GNU/Linux distribution's issue tracker.Is it legal to use qBittorrent?qBittorrent is a peer to peer (P2P) file sharing software.Although the software is perfectly legal, it may be illegal to download restricted content with this software, depending on the law in your country.Why use qBittorrent instead of another client?A lot of other BitTorrent clients exist but qBittorrent has several advantages:It is Open-source/Free/Libre Software (you can see the code and see what qBittorrent is doing).It is the closest open-source equivalent to the extremely popular (and Windows only) BitTorrent client: µTorrent.Its development team is very active and friendly.It is stable and it has a low footprint (generally, 20-60 MiB of RAM used), whilst providing all the features you may need.It uses the high-tech libtorrent-rasterbar library, which means greater download and upload speed as well as excellent support of the
